Ābkareh
Ābkareh is an abandoned farm in Ilam Province, Iran. Ābkareh is situated nearby to the village Hamgam, as well as near Mirza Hoseynabad.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Aliabad
Village
Aliabad is a village in Majin Rural District, Majin District, Darreh Shahr County, Ilam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 57, in 10 families. The village is populated by Lurs. Aliabad is situated 2½ km east of Ābkareh.
